DevExtreme拥有高性能的HTML5 / JavaScript小部件集合,使您可以利用现代Web开发堆栈(包括React,Angular,ASP.NET Core,jQuery,Knockout等)构建交互式的Web应用程序。从Angular和Reac,到ASP.NET Core或Vue,DevExtreme包含全面的高性能和响应式UI小部件集合,可在传统Web和下一代移动应用程序中使用。 该套件附带功能齐全的数据网格、交互式图表小部件、数据编辑器等。
DevExtreme已正式发布了v21.2,新版本持续增强HTML/Markdown 编辑器、流程图控件的功能等,欢迎下载最新版体验!
HTML/Markdown编辑器
表格管理
此更新包括以下与表格相关的功能:
- 支持 'thead' HTML 标签(表头)。
- 通过新的tableResizing 配置选项支持表和列调整大小操作。
- 表相关操作的上下文菜单。 要启用菜单,请激活 tableContextMenu 设置。
- 表格单元格中的多段落支持(<p> 标签)。
- 表上下文菜单自定义。
- 通过内置对话框管理表格/单元格属性。
软换行符
HTML/Markdown 编辑器包含一个新的 allowSoftLineBreak 配置选项,启用后,用户可以将单个块元素中的文本分成多行(通过 <br> 标签使用新的 Shift+Enter 键盘快捷键),此功能允许您将列表项 (<li>) 拆分为多行或添加多行单元格。
流程图
增强触控支持
新版本改进了基于 Chromium 的浏览器(Google Chrome、Microsoft Edge、Opera)中的触摸屏支持。
甘特图
可见日期范围
您现在可以使用 startDateRange 和endDateRange属性指定可见数据范围。
排序
您现在可以按一列或多列对任务进行排序,使用我们的新排序选项来配置相应的 UI 元素及其操作。
导出为 PDF
您现在可以将甘特图数据导出为 PDF。 导出选项允许您设置文档大小和页面方向; 将数据导出限制在特定日期范围内; 指定是仅导出图表区域、树列表区域还是整个甘特图组件。
过滤
甘特图控件现在支持过滤,最终用户可以使用标题过滤器或过滤器行来过滤任务。 要过滤代码中的任务,请使用以下 API:
用于展开/折叠任务的新 API
与任务相关的(展开/折叠)API 增强功能包括:
- expandAll - 展开所有任务。
- collapseAll - 折叠所有任务。
- expandAllToLevel - 将所有任务扩展到指定级别(根任务的深度为零)。
- expandToTask - 展开所有任务来使指定的任务可见。
- collapseTask - 折叠指定的任务。
- expandTask - 展开指定的任务。
API 增强功能
甘特图控件 API 增强功能包括:
- showDependencies - 指定依赖关系是否在图表区域中可见。
- showResources 和 showDependencies - 显示/隐藏相应的 UI 元素。
- scaleTypeRange - 允许您限制缩放范围。
- refresh - 重新加载数据并重绘整个组件。
DevExpress技术交流群6:600715373 欢迎一起进群讨论